Who is Hiroshi Yasuda?
Prof. Dr. of Engineering Hiroshi Yasuda is an Emeritus Professor at the University of Tokyo and works as a Consultant for Nippon Telegraph and Telephone.
In the sphere of international standardization, together with Dr. Leonardo Chiariglione he founded the Moving Picture Experts Group which standardized MPEG-1 Audio Layer 3, better known as MP3.
Prof. Hiroshi Yasuda received his B.E., M.E. and Dr.E. degrees from the University of Tokyo, Japan in 1967, 1969, and 1972 respectively. Thereafter, he joined the Electrical Communication Laboratories of NTT in 1972 where he has been involved in works on Video Coding, Facsimile Network, Image Processing, Telepresence, B-ISDN Network and Services, Internet and Computer Communication Applications. He worked four years as the Executive Manager of Visual Media Lab. of NTT Human Interface Labs., and served three years as the Executive Manager of System Services Department of NTT Business Communications Systems Headquarters and became Vice President, Director of NTT Information and Communication Systems Laboratories at Yokosuka since July 1995. After serving twenty-five years for NTT he left NTT to work at The University of Tokyo. From 2003 until 2005 he was acting director of The Center for Collaborative Research and is now a Professor at Tokyo Denki University. He is a member of the IT Strategic Headquarters.
